Toradora!

immortal work ☆☆☆☆☆

Basic Information

  • Title: Toradora!
  • Genre: Romantic comedy, slice of life, drama
  • Source Material: Light novel series written by Yuyuko Takemiya and illustrated by Yasu
  • Production:
    • Studio: J.C.Staff
    • Original Airing: 2008–2009 (25 episodes)

Plot Summary

Toradora! follows the story of Ryuuji Takasu, a high school student whose intimidating face hides his gentle nature, and Taiga Aisaka, a small but fierce girl known as the “Palmtop Tiger.” Initially, the two form an unlikely alliance to help each other win over their respective crushes. As they spend more time together, their friendship deepens, leading both to confront unexpected truths about themselves, their feelings, and what love really means.


Main Characters

  • Ryuuji Takasu:
    Despite his rough appearance, Ryuuji is kind, responsible, and caring. His sensitivity and inner warmth contrast sharply with the first impression he gives.
  • Taiga Aisaka:
    Known as the “Palmtop Tiger” due to her small stature and fierce temperament, Taiga is complex and vulnerable. Beneath her tough exterior lies a young girl grappling with personal and family challenges.
  • Minori Kushieda:
    A cheerful and energetic classmate whose optimism and vivacity add brightness to the story, Minori plays an important role in the evolving dynamics among the group.
  • Ami Kawashima:
    Initially portrayed as a charming and popular girl, Ami’s character reveals hidden layers as her own struggles and aspirations come to light.
  • Kitamura Yusaku:
    Ryuuji’s close friend who provides support and insight, contributing to the everyday realism and emotional grounding of the narrative.

Themes

  • Love and Friendship:
    The series explores the evolution of relationships, emphasizing that love can emerge unexpectedly and often challenges preconceived notions about friendship and romance.
  • Personal Growth and Self-Acceptance:
    Characters learn to understand and accept their true selves, overcoming internal conflicts and societal expectations as they grow emotionally.
  • Family and Identity:
    The story delves into the impact of family dynamics on personal identity, highlighting how past experiences shape who we become.

Symbolism

  • The “Tiger” Persona:
    Taiga’s nickname symbolizes both her fierce independence and the hidden vulnerability beneath her hardened exterior.
  • Facades vs. True Self:
    Many characters struggle with the gap between how they are perceived and who they truly are, using their outward behavior to mask inner insecurities and emotional wounds.
  • Bridges and Connections:
    The evolving relationships throughout the series serve as a metaphor for overcoming isolation and building meaningful connections, symbolizing the journey toward understanding and empathy.
